City of Santa Barbara Home Page NewsThe Community Development Block Grant Program
 The American Recovery and Reinvestment Act of 2009 (Recovery Act) was signed into law by President Obama on February 17th, 2009. The City of Santa Barbara expects to receive $289,274 in additional funding to be used for projects that emphasize job creation and economic benefit. The department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) requires the City to make a substantial amendment to its 2008/2009 Action Plan, which outlines the City’s proposed use of CDBG-R funds.

City of Santa Barbara Home Page NewsJuly 4th Fireworks
 The City of Santa Barbara and SPARKLE will co-host a fireworks display off of West Beach beginning at 9pm, Saturday, July 4. Fireworks produced by Pyro Spectaculars. Fireworks will be launched from the beach for approximately 22 minutes. All of West Beach is open for free viewing. ADA accessibility information can be found at www.santabarbaraca.gov/July4ADA. MTD bus and shuttle services, street closures, July 4th parade and symphony, visit www.santabarbaraca.gov or call 805-564-5418.
